ijskoffie

Etymology

[edit]

Compound of ijs (ice) +‎ koffie (coffee).

Noun

[edit]

ijskoffie m or f (plural ijskoffies)

  1. iced coffee; a serving of iced coffee.

Usage notes

[edit]

Masculine in Belgium and the southern Netherlands, historically feminine in the northern Netherlands.
